THERE IS-ARE , MUCH-MANY-A LOT OF DOMINO. with rules. BLACK and WHITE VERSION INCLUDED!!!
This worksheet will help you practise countable and uncountable expressions of quantity. There are 24 domino cards so you can divide your students into groups of 3. Each group should have one set of cut up cards. Each student draws 4 dominoes. After the 1st student places his/her domino on the table, the next one must place a domino next to it, as...
